GAME OF THE WEEK
Mighty Squirrels (1-1) vs. Gouging Anklebiters (2-0)
Location: Tompkins West, 4:00 PM
All-Time Series: Mighty Squirrels lead 4-1-1
Game Notes: The Mighty Squirrels snapped a 12-game losing streak last week with a solid win against Mexican Standoff.Ā  After lying dormant for 75 minutes of play, the Squirrels’ offense finally awoke when Arthur “Lil Weezy” Revechkis scored their first goal of the 2009 season.Ā  Also promising was new goalie Eric Ramirez, who made a splash in his debut, holding the potent Standoff offense to no goals.Ā  With their two victories to open the season, the Gouging Anklebiters are already halfway to equaling their four wins from 2008.Ā  Their latest win, a stunning upset over the Rehabs, proves that the Anklebiters are putting their foot down and can no longer be taken lightly.Ā  The Anklebiters will look to stay undefeated as they face a familiar Schloeder Division foe.
Keys To The Game:
1. Nestor Nonato’s return to BTSH has buoyed theĀ attack of the Gouging Anklebiters.Ā  His offensive prowess has beenĀ a key component to their fast start.
2. Despite getting a little dinged up last week (as usual), Mighty Squirrels shutdown defender Marie Marberg is probable for this game.
3.Ā  Eric “El Guapo” DiPierri scored the game-winning goal for the Anklebiters last week.Ā  However, captain Phil “Sandy” Donohue remains steadfast in keeping him relegated to the eighth line.
Eliā€™s Pick: Gouging Anklebiters.Ā  Another win or two and Charles DeFranco might even start talking some trash.
Derekā€™s Pick: Mighty Squirrels.Ā  Tim “(S)crappy” Gray has been conspicuously absent so far this season.Ā  This can only mean good things for the Squirrels.
